tracepoints: Move struct tracepoint to new tracepoint-defs.h header



Steven recommended open coding access to tracepoint->key to add
trace points to headers. Unfortunately this is difficult for some
headers (such as x86 asm/msr.h) because including tracepoint.h
includes so many other headers that it causes include loops.
The main problem is the include of linux/rcupdate.h, which
pulls in a lot of other headers. The rcu header is only needed
when actually defining trace points.

Move the struct tracepoint into a separate tracepoint-defs.h
header that can be included without pulling in all of RCU.
